Hi Nancy -

To post a photo in a thread:

Reply to an existing thread, or create a new post. BEFORE you submit your text, scroll down to where is says "Attach file:". Click on the "Browse" button, and go to where your photo is located on your hard drive. Then you can submit.

If you submit before attaching the file, you will have to create a new post to attach the photo.

A note on size - I find that keeping the photo about 2 inches wide makes it fit nicely in the screen. .jpg extensions are generally smaller than .bmp extensions, so if you can use jpg's they'll load faster.

For your avatar, you need to resize a photo to no bigger than 50x50 pixels. Microsoft provides a photo editor in their Microsoft Office folder which allows you to change the size of the photos by inches or pixels, as well as allowing you to crop them.

Once you have the 50x50 pixel photo, go to "user cp" (button at the top of the screen - first one on the right half of the screen). Choose "edit options" and scroll all the way down. At the bottom you will see a place to upload your avatar.
